About

Futaba Kazama is a scholar working on Water Science and Technology, Pollution and Environmental Chemistry. According to data from OpenAlex, Futaba Kazama has authored 104 papers receiving a total of 3.3k indexed citations (citations by other indexed papers that have themselves been cited), including 39 papers in Water Science and Technology, 34 papers in Pollution and 19 papers in Environmental Chemistry. Recurrent topics in Futaba Kazama’s work include Wastewater Treatment and Nitrogen Removal (31 papers), Groundwater and Isotope Geochemistry (19 papers) and Water resources management and optimization (15 papers). Futaba Kazama is often cited by papers focused on Wastewater Treatment and Nitrogen Removal (31 papers), Groundwater and Isotope Geochemistry (19 papers) and Water resources management and optimization (15 papers). Futaba Kazama collaborates with scholars based in Japan, Thailand and Nepal. Futaba Kazama's co-authors include Sangam Shrestha, Vishnu Prasad Pandey, Sujata Manandhar, Saroj Kumar Chapagain, Takashi Nakamura, Mukand S. Babel, Kazuichi Isaka, Yuya Kimura, Sylvain Perret and Tatsuo Sumino and has published in prestigious journals such as Bioresource Technology, Journal of Hydrology and Environment International.
